Olivia Rodrigo is back with her third studio album, You Seem Pretty Sad for a Girl So in Love. This new offering features 13 tracks chock-full of “sad love songs,” in her words, including “Stupid Song” and “U + Me = <3.” The internet is abuzz with excitement, likely because it’s been nearly three years since the pop singer/songwriter released an album, her last being Guts from 2023.
In an Instagram message posted Friday (June 12), Rodrigo wrote, “I love this album so much. The record is a time capsule of a relationship in all of its highs and lows. It’s my attempt at capturing love from both sides of the coin. The hope and the disappointment. The insanity and the clarity. The entanglement and the unraveling.”
